Ingredients
- 2 boneless skinless chicken breast halves (1/2 pound)
 - 2 teaspoons olive oil
 - 1/8 teaspoon dried basil
 - 1/8 teaspoon dried oregano
 - 1/4 teaspoon garlic salt, optional
 - 1/4 teaspoon pepper
 - 1/4 teaspoon paprika
 - 4 cups torn romaine
 - 1 small tomato, thinly sliced
 - Creamy Caesar salad dressing
 - Caesar salad croutons, optional
 
Instructions
Steps:
- Brush chicken with oil. Combine the basil, oregano, garlic salt if desired, pepper and paprika; sprinkle over chicken. Grill, uncovered, over medium-low heat for 12-15 minutes or until a thermometer reads 170°, turning several times.
 - Arrange romaine and tomato on plates. Cut chicken into strips; arrange over salads. Drizzle with dressing. Sprinkle with croutons if desired.
